I'm looking to build a micro ATX system based on an Antec Aria case and an Athlon XP 2600. I'm trying to decide between a DFI KM400-MLV (KM400 northbridge, 8237 southbridge w/SATA) and a Chaintech 7NIL1 (NVIDIA nForce2 Ultra 400 + MCP) motherboard. I don'tcare about theintegrated video, but SATA on the 8237 southbridge and 8 USB ports is a bonus, but there's no FSB400 support. The southbridge on the Chaintech 7NIL1 does not have SoundStorm audio and I have heard concerns over the stability of the drivers for the nForce2 chipsets.
Has anyone had any experience with either of those motherboards? I've also seen the Biostar M7VIZ (only PCB v5.1 supports SATA though...), ECS KM400A-M2, and the MSI KM4AM-L mentioned, but I really can't find much info on them. The ECS and MSI boards seem to be based on the little-known KM400A chipset, which addsFSB 400 support.
